  • v2.4.0
    3f7fa412 · Update AUTHORS ·
    What's new?
    
    New S3 storage driver
    The default s3 storage driver is now implemented on top of the official Amazon
    S3 SDK, boasting major performance and stability goodness. The previous storage
    is still available, but deprecated.
    
    Garbage Collector
    A garbage collector command has been added to the registry.
    
    Tagged Manifest Events
    Manifest push and pull events will now include the tag which was used in the
    operation (if applicable).
    
    Relative URLs
    The registry can now be configured to return relative URLs in Location headers.
    
    V1 Signature disabled
    With the ongoing adoption of the schema 2 manifest format and deprecation of
    signatures, this option will improve pull performance by generating and
    returning a single libtrust signature.
    
    Gotchas
    
    The RADOS storage driver has been removed. The registry can still be used with
    Ceph as the storage backend using the swift driver in conjunction with the Swift
    API gateway.
    
    The command line format has changed to support subcommands. To run a registry as
    before an additional subcommand - serve - is required.
    
    The legacy S3 storage driver, based on adroll/goamz is now deprecated and will
    be removed in a future release.

  • v2.3.0
    Docker Registry v2.3.0
    
    What’s new?
    
    This Docker Registry release is the first to support the Image Manifest Version 2, Schema 2
    manifest format.
    
    This new schema version has two primary goals. The first is to move the Docker
    engine towards content-addressable images, by supporting an image model where
    the image's configuration can be hashed to generate an ID for the image. The
    second is to allow multi-architecture images, through a "fat manifest" which
    references image manifests for platform-specific versions of an image.
    
    For details, see https://github.com/docker/distribution/blob/master/docs/spec/manifest-v2-2.md
    
    Cross Repository Blob Mount
    
    Previously the registry required all blob data to be uploaded to a repository,
    even if it existed in the Registry’s blob store.  This was a security measure to
    ensure the clients owned the data they intended to upload.
    
    Cross Repository Mount now enables an existing blob to be mounted into the target
    repository if it already exists in a repository which the user has pull access
    to.  This can reduce the amount of data transferred when pushing images.
    
    For details, see: https://github.com/docker/distribution/issues/634
    
    Additionally there are a number of performance improvements, bug fixes and
    documentation updates.
    
    Gotchas
    
    In certain cases, pull by digest will not work.  For details, see
    https://github.com/docker/distribution/blob/master/docs/compatibility.md

  • v2.2.0
    Docker Registry v2.2
    
    This Docker Registry release brings a new storage driver implementation to the
    Docker Registry along with bug fixes, documentation enhancements and logging
    improvements.
    
    What’s new?
    
    Google Cloud Storage Driver
    The Registry now supports Google's reliable and fast network and storage
    infrastructure for layer and manifest storage.
    
    Read-only mode
    Enables a Registry to serve only read requests, useful to maintain read
    availability during unsafe administrative tasks.
    
    Configurable hostname support
    Allows the specification of an externally-reachable URL for the Registry.
    
    Improved handling of environmental variables
    Enables environment variables to be specified which are not part of the
    configuration file.
    
    Configurable file-existence and HTTP health checks
    Allows administrators to easily disable a registry temporarily by placing a file
    on the filesystem.  Additionally a registry can be configured to check the
    health of other services, such as notification endpoints.
    
    Enable configurable HTTP headers to be set in responses
    This feature is usable for Registry administrators to set response headers for
    various uses cases including increased security.
    
    Redirect Support in the Swift Driver
    The Swift storage driver now supports generating download URLs in line with
    other cloud storage drivers.
    
    Gotchas
    
    In order to support valid hostnames as name components, supporting repeated dash
    was added.  Additionally double underscore is now allowed as a separator to
    loosen the restriction for previously supported names.
